The Technical Process Behind Structural Drying And Dehumidification in Franklinton, LA

Below is the calculated, documented process our Franklinton, LA teams follow.

Professional Structural Drying And Dehumidification technician working in Franklinton, LA
01

Psychrometric Drying Assessment

The assessment sets the baseline every later reading gets measured against.

02

Thermal Imaging Moisture Mapping

Thermal cameras scan walls, ceilings, and flooring to reveal moisture invisible to the naked eye.

03

Air Mover & Dehumidifier Placement

Dehumidifier capacity is matched to the calculated moisture load for that specific space.

04

Daily Drying Log Monitoring

A technician returns daily to take moisture readings and log progress against the drying plan.

05

Specialty Drying for Hardwood & Cabinetry

We adjust drying speed for sensitive materials like hardwood and cabinetry to prevent secondary damage.

06

Final Dry-Standard Verification

Final verification compares closing readings against the material-specific dry standard, not a general guess.

Frequently Asked Questions About Structural Drying And Dehumidification in Franklinton, LA

A room can look dry on the surface while moisture meters still detect trapped moisture inside materials.

Psychrometrics uses scientific formulas to size the drying plan to the actual moisture load.

Typical drying time is 3-5 days for standard materials, longer for sensitive ones like hardwood.

Daily documentation is standard, giving you real data rather than just an assurance.

Specialty drying protocols protect hardwood and cabinetry from the damage a standard drying speed could cause.

A stall in the daily logs triggers a plan review rather than simply leaving equipment running unchanged.

Franklinton is a town in, and the parish seat of Washington Parish, Louisiana, United States. The population was 3,857 at the 2010 census. The elevation is an average of 155 feet (47 m) above sea level. Franklinton is located 61 miles (98 km) north of New Orleans.
